How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Virginia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Virginia Park Studio Apartments | $1,960 | $1,030 | $3,060 |
| Virginia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,883 | $800 | $3,725 |
| Virginia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,132 | $846 | $4,175 |
Virginia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,473 | $655 | $4,575 |
| Virginia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,778 | $800 | $5,600 |
| Virginia Park 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,957 | $1,285 | $5,500 |
| Virginia Park 6 Bedroom Apartments | $4,834 | $1,295 | $8,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Virginia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Virginia Park with 3 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in Virginia Park is at Sun Terrace Apartments listed at $2,100.
How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Virginia Park Apartment?
The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Virginia Park is $2,473.
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Virginia Park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Virginia Park is a 1,700 square feet unit starting from $2,743 at The Villas at Main Street.
What is the average size for Virginia Park 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Virginia Park is currently 1,546 sq ft.
